Support R7RS.

* module/Makefile.am: Add r7rs-libraries.scm as dependency for boot-9.go.
  (SOURCES): Add $(R7RS_SOURCES).
  (R7RS_SOURCES): New variable.
  (NOCOMP_SOURCES): Add ice-9/r7rs-libraries.scm.

* module/ice-9/boot-9.scm: Include r7rs-libraries.scm.
  (%cond-expand-features): Add r7rs, exact-closed, ieee-float,
  full-unicode, and ratios.  Add TODO comments.
  (%cond-expand): New procedure, derived from code in 'cond-expand'.
  (cond-expand): Reimplement in terms of '%cond-expand'.

* module/ice-9/r7rs-libraries.scm:
  module/scheme/base.scm:
  module/scheme/case-lambda.scm:
  module/scheme/char.scm:
  module/scheme/complex.scm:
  module/scheme/cxr.scm:
  module/scheme/eval.scm:
  module/scheme/file.scm:
  module/scheme/inexact.scm:
  module/scheme/lazy.scm:
  module/scheme/load.scm:
  module/scheme/process-context.scm:
  module/scheme/r5rs.scm:
  module/scheme/read.scm:
  module/scheme/repl.scm:
  module/scheme/time.scm:
  module/scheme/write.scm: New files.

;;; r7rs-libraries.scm --- Support for the R7RS `define-library' form

;; This file is included from boot-9.scm and assumes the existence of
;; (and expands into) procedures and syntactic forms defined therein.
(define-syntax define-library
(lambda (form)
(syntax-case form ()
((_ (module-name ...) (decl-type . decl-args) ...)
(and-map (lambda (x)
(or (identifier? x)
(exact-integer? (syntax->datum x)))) ; XXX FIXME handle exact integers properly
#'(module-name ...))
(let loop ((decls #'((decl-type . decl-args) ...))
(imports '())
(exports '())
(bodies '()))
(if (null? decls)
#`(library (module-name ...)
(export #,@(reverse exports))
(import #,@(reverse imports))
#,@(reverse bodies))
(let ((decl (car decls)))
(define (splice-in xs)
(loop (append xs (cdr decls)) imports exports bodies))
(define (new-imports specs)
(loop (cdr decls) (append (reverse specs) imports) exports bodies))
(define (new-exports specs)
(loop (cdr decls) imports (append (reverse specs) exports) bodies))
(define (new-bodies xs)
(loop (cdr decls) imports exports (append (reverse xs) bodies)))
(syntax-case decl (export
import
begin
include
include-ci
include-library-declarations
cond-expand)
((export spec ...)
(let ()
(define (convert-spec spec)
(syntax-case spec (rename)
((rename id1 id2)
(and (identifier? #'id1)
(identifier? #'id2))
#'(rename (id1 id2)))
(id
(identifier? #'id)
#'id)
(_ (syntax-violation 'export "invalid export spec"
decl spec))))
(new-exports (map convert-spec #'(spec ...)))))
((import set ...)
(new-imports #'(set ...)))
((begin cmd-or-defn ...)
(new-bodies #'(cmd-or-defn ...)))
((include filename1 filename2 ...)
(and-map (lambda (fn)
(string? (syntax->datum fn)))
#'(filename1 filename2 ...))
(new-bodies (%read-files-for-include #'(filename1 filename2 ...)
#f
decl)))
((include-ci filename1 filename2 ...)
(and-map (lambda (fn)
(string? (syntax->datum fn)))
#'(filename1 filename2 ...))
(new-bodies (%read-files-for-include #'(filename1 filename2 ...)
#t
decl)))
((include-library-declarations filename1 filename2 ...)
(and-map (lambda (fn)
(string? (syntax->datum fn)))
#'(filename1 filename2 ...))
(splice-in (%read-files-for-include #'(filename1 filename2 ...)
#f
decl)))
((cond-expand clause1 clause2 ...)
(splice-in (%cond-expand decl)))))))))))

(define (finite? z)
(and (r6rs-finite? (real-part z))
(r6rs-finite? (imag-part z))))
(define (infinite? z)
(or (r6rs-infinite? (real-part z))
(r6rs-infinite? (imag-part z))))
(define (nan? z)
(or (r6rs-nan? (real-part z))
(r6rs-nan? (imag-part z))))))
